IN LOVING MEMORY OF
Marcus H.
Marx
January 2, 1930 – April 19, 2018
Marcus H. Marx, age 88, passed away peacefully at Sienna Crest in Waunakee on Apr. 19, 2018 surrounded by his family. He was born at home in Roxbury on Jan. 2, 1930 to the late Werner and Alvina (Breunig) Marx. Marcus was united in marriage to Doris C. Rauls on June 29, 1954; she preceded him in death on July 11, 2009. Together they farmed in Roxbury on the Marx homestead where Marcus has lived since 1936. He enjoyed traveling and his Sunday afternoon drives. Marcus was proud of his German Heritage and his Catholic Faith; he was a member of St. Patrick's Catholic Church in Lodi.
He is survived by his eight children, Donna (Ed) Ziegler, Phil (Holly) Marx, Lois Marx, Janet (Scott) Tiedeman, Yvonne (Paul) Edmunds, David (Mary Ann) Marx, Joe (Michelle) Marx, and John (Susan)Marx; 23 grandchildren; 15 great grandchildren; 3 sisters, Virginia Bongard, Mary Walsh, and Jean (Tom) Walsh; sister in-law, Bernice Marx; numerous other relatives and friends.
In addition to his parents and wife, Doris; he was preceded in death by his siblings, Vincent Marx, Florence (John) Rupel, Helen (Bud) Neumaier, Bernadine (David) Treinen, Eileen Exterovich, and an infant sister, Elizabeth; brother in-laws, Pat Walsh, and Charles Bongard.
A Mass of Christian Burial will be held at 11:00 am on Apr. 26, 2018 at St. Patrick's Catholic Church, 521 Fair St., Lodi. Interment will follow in the St. Norbert's Cemetery. A visitation will be held from 3:00 pm until 7:00 pm on Apr. 25, 2018 at Hooverson Funeral Home, 251 Water St., Sauk City. Visitation will continue the morning of mass one hour prior to the service at church.
Marcus' family would like to express their sincerest appreciation to the entire staff and especially Katie Olivares at Sienna Crest in Waunakee for their wonderful and dignified care.
